What is Tajikistani Somoni (TJS)

The Tajikistani Somoni (TJS) is the official currency of Tajikistan, a mountainous country located in Central Asia. Introduced in 2000, the somoni replaced the Tajikistani ruble at a rate of 1 somoni for 1,000 rubles. The currency is named after the Persian poet Rudaki, whose full name is Abu Abdollah Rudaki, with "somoni" being derived from "Samanid," the name of a Persian dynasty that ruled over the region.

The somoni is subdivided into 100 dirams. Banknotes are available in denominations of 1, 5, 10, 20, 50, 100, 200, and even 500 somoni, while coins are available in 1, 3, 5, 10, 20, 25, and 50 dirams. The currency is symbolized as TJS. As with many countries, the value of the somoni can fluctuate due to various economic factors including inflation, monetary policy, and international trade conditions.

What is South Sudanese Pound (SSP)

The South Sudanese pound (SSP) is the official currency of South Sudan, a country that gained independence from Sudan in 2011. The currency was introduced in July of that year, with the aim of establishing a sovereign national currency for the new nation. One of the main reasons for its introduction was to replace the Sudanese pound, which was used before independence.

The SSP is subdivided into 100 piastres. Banknotes are issued in denominations of 1, 5, 10, 20, 50, 100, 500, and 1,000 pounds, while coins are available in smaller denominations. The currency code for the South Sudanese pound is SSP, and it is commonly represented by the symbol "£".

The economic environment in South Sudan can be quite volatile, influenced by various factors such as conflict, oil prices, and agricultural productivity. Due to the challenges faced by the economy, the SSP has experienced fluctuations in value against major world currencies, including the Tajikistani somoni.
